Message type: E = Error
Message class: CATSXT - Time Sheet
Message number: 150
Message text: Negative minimal value is not allowed

- Negative minimal value is not allowed ?The SAP error message CATSXT150 "Negative minimal value is not allowed" typically occurs in the context of the Cross-Application Time Sheet (CATS) when users attempt to enter a negative value in a field that does not accept negative numbers. This can happen in various scenarios, such as when entering time data, expenses, or other related entries.
Cause:
- Negative Time Entry: The most common cause is that a user is trying to enter a negative time value (e.g., -1 hour) in a time entry field.
- Configuration Issues: There may be configuration settings in the CATS module that do not allow negative values for certain fields.
- Data Entry Error: Users may inadvertently enter a negative sign due to a typographical error.
Solution:
- Check Input Values: Ensure that all time entries or values being entered are positive. Review the data being inputted to confirm that no negative values are present.
- Review Configuration: If you have access to the configuration settings, check the settings related to time entry in CATS. Ensure that the system is configured to accept only positive values where applicable.
- User Training: Provide training or guidelines to users on how to correctly enter data in the CATS system to avoid negative values.
- Error Handling: Implement error handling in the data entry process to catch negative values before they are submitted.
